How did the use of ChatGPT at Freshworks impact the software development timeline?

socratic-gpt
Socrates

The use of ChatGPT at Freshworks significantly impacted the software development timeline by drastically reducing it. According to the information provided, developers at Freshworks were able to cut down the development time from around 10 weeks to less than a week by using ChatGPT to write code. This example demonstrates the potential of AI tools like ChatGPT in accelerating the coding process and enhancing productivity in the software development industry.

What are the various capabilities of generative AI in the context of software development as described in the article?

socratic-gpt
Socrates

The article highlights several capabilities of generative AI in the context of software development:

  1. Gathering requirements: Generative AI can aid in generating a list of requirements for software development and reviewing them to ensure nothing is missed.
  2. Generating code: It can transform natural language instructions into functioning code, effectively turning English (or any other language) into a computer programming language.
  3. Completing code: Generative AI tools can suggest code completions as developers type, saving time and reducing human errors, particularly in repetitive or mundane tasks.
  4. Reviewing code: AI can analyze existing code, suggest improvements, and create more efficient alternatives. It can also analyze code according to coding style guidelines to ensure consistency.
  5. Fixing bugs: Generative AI can identify and fix bugs in code to create a better end product.
  6. Testing software: AI can perform many testing phases, such as generating test cases, test code, and analyzing test results.
  7. Predicting software failures: In the future, generative AI may predict how systems and software might fail before the code goes into production and suggest fixes for developers.

These capabilities can help developers work smarter, tackle more complex problems, and come up with more creative solutions, ultimately speeding up the software development process4.

How does generative AI enhance the requirement gathering process in software development?

socratic-gpt
Socrates

Generative AI enhances the requirement gathering process in software development by automating the collection and organization of requirements. AI-driven tools can analyze vast amounts of data, including existing documentation and user feedback, to produce comprehensive and coherent requirement documents. This automation not only speeds up the process but also enhances the accuracy of the requirements gathered2.

Generative AI can also assist in creating detailed work breakdown structures and schedules, making the planning phase more precise and efficient. By leveraging machine learning algorithms, Generative AI enhances the accuracy and consistency of requirements documentation, minimizing errors and misunderstandings between stakeholders and development teams2.

Furthermore, Generative AI models are capable of creating realistic and diverse data sets for testing purposes. These synthetic data sets support comprehensive testing efforts without compromising data security or integrity. By learning from past data and tests, AI can ensure that testing covers all necessary scenarios.

In summary, Generative AI improves the requirement gathering process by automating tasks, enhancing accuracy, ensuring consistency, and facilitating comprehensive testing. This allows developers to focus on more complex and creative tasks, ultimately leading to increased efficiency and reduced errors in software development1.
